Sat Jun 4 201619:25Red Sox's Swihart, Hanigan injured in game against Jays
BOSTON -- Boston Red Sox left fielder Blake Swihart and catcher Ryan Hanigan both left Saturday's game against the Toronto Blue Jays in the seventh inning with injuries.After Hanigan left the game at the start of the seventh inning with a neck strain, Swihart suffered a left ankle injury later in the inning.Swihart, who has been converted from a catcher into an outfielder, appeared to make a running catch of Michael Saunders' foul fly into the field corner. With the ball in his glove, he hit the side wall and went down.After being helped part of the way back to the dugout, Swihart was able to make it the rest of the way on his own, walking slowly with a limp. He struggled getting down the dugout steps.To add insult to injury, the Blue Jays challenged the catch and the call was overturned because the ball was judged to have hit the wall before entering Swihart's glove.Hanigan was guilty of three passed balls on knuckleballer Steven Wright pitches, leading to all three runs against Wright.

Sat May 21 201603:34C/LF Blake Swihart made first career start in left field Friday,...
C/LF Blake Swihart made his first career start in left field Friday, going 0-for-3 while taking the place of INF/OF Brock Holt (mild concussion). "He made the plays he needed to make," teammate and Red Sox center fielder Jackie Bradley Jr. said. "He's put the work in and he's going to only get better. The 24-year-old was called up from Triple-A Pawtucket before the game. Swihart appeared in six games as a catcher for Boston before being optioned to Pawtucket on April 15 and converted to an outfielder. Over 29 games with Pawtucket (15 at catcher, 22 in the outfield), Swihart had a .243/.344/.311 slash line with one home run and eight RBIs. He committed two errors on 46 total chances in the outfield during that stretch.
